Unit 1: Application to a Research Track
When we meet our ILC students, we ask them why they want to become engineers. Many students admit that they chose engineering because they know an engineer, because someone said they should become an engineer, or because engineers earn higher-paying salaries. They are less familiar with the kind of work engineers actually do and how writing functions as an important part of an engineer’s job. To acquaint students with the work and concerns of engineers, students complete their first assignment, an Application to a Research Track Memo (Unit 1). For this assignment, students choose one of the following engineering challenges to explore during the semester: expanding world population, pollution, energy, transportation, infrastructure, or aerospace. After selecting a challenge, students investigate the issue by rhetorically analyzing an argument about a facet of the challenge (Unit 2), interview a specialist and design a website about the kinds of writing engineers do (Unit 3), and finally, write a Documented Argument Essay concerning one aspect of the challenge (Unit 4).
In addition to Unit 1 serving as the foundation for the other learning units, the Application to a Research Track Memo assignment encourages students to explore engineering-specific discourse communities to which they hope to belong. Reading assignments aid students in better understanding how writing, rhetoric, and engineering intersect and how engineers use writing through various genres to “routinely communicate their discoveries and progress to peers, managers, other engineers, and the community” (Oakes, Leone, and Gunn 363). During Unit 1, students are dependent on the instructor to introduce them to important course terms and concepts and to lead them through the reading assignments with task-specific instructions; however, students participate actively in their own learning by selecting an engineering challenge based on their own interests. In addition, they begin to develop community with peers by working with others in their research tracks, and they develop a sense of pre-professional identity as an “engineer in training.” Once choosing a research track to explore, students become more invested in the course: they begin to see writing as a way to investigate topics that interest them and that apply to their lives as college students and future professionals.
